Overview
- Lauren Sintes confirmed her departure from 'Made In Chelsea' in a candid video statement, marking the end of her two-year run on the show.
- She revealed that emotional exhaustion and frustration with co-stars led to her decision, including a mid-season break during filming.
- Sintes reflected on her struggles with online trolling and hinted at 'mean girl behavior' from a castmate, further influencing her choice to leave.
- Her exit has garnered public support from fans and co-stars like Jazz Saunders and Junaid Ahmed, who praised her time on the show.
- Known for her outspoken personality, Sintes described her journey as both challenging and transformative, leaving behind a legacy of boldness and candor.
